Презентация, доклад Сжатие данных (11 класс)

Содержание

2. По каналу связи передаются сообщения, содержащие только семь букв: А, Б, В, Г, Д, Е и Ж. Для передачи используется двоичный код, удовлетворяющий условию Фано. Для буквы А используется кодовое слово 1; для буквы Б

Слайд 11. По каналу связи с помощью равномерного двоичного кода передаются сообщения,

содержащие только 4 буквы А, Б, В, Г. Каждой букве соответствует своё кодовое слово, при этом для набора кодовых слов выполнено такое свойство: любые два слова из набора отличаются не менее чем в трёх позициях. Это свойство важно для расшифровки сообщений при наличии помех. Для кодирования букв Б, В, Г используются 5-битовые кодовые слова: Б: 00001, В: 01111, Г: 10110. 5-битовый код для буквы А начинается с 1 и заканчивается на 0. Определите кодовое слово для буквы А. (109)

1. По каналу связи с помощью равномерного двоичного кода передаются сообщения, содержащие только 4 буквы А, Б,

Слайд 22. По каналу связи передаются сообщения, содержащие только семь букв: А,

Б, В, Г, Д, Е и Ж. Для передачи используется двоичный код, удовлетворяющий условию Фано. Для буквы А используется кодовое слово 1; для буквы Б используется кодовое слово 01. Какова минимальная общая длина кодовых слов для всех семи букв? (110)

2. По каналу связи передаются сообщения, содержащие только семь букв: А, Б, В, Г, Д, Е и

Слайд 33. Данные объемом 60 Мбайт передаются из пункта А в пункт

Б по каналу связи, обеспечивающему скорость передачи данных 220 бит в секунду, а затем из пункта Б в пункт В по каналу связи, обеспечивающему скорость передачи данных 223 бит в секунду. От начала передачи данных из пункта А до их полного получения в пункте В прошло 10 минут. Сколько времени в секундах составила задержка в пункте Б, т.е. время между окончанием приема данных из пункта А и началом передачи данных в пункт В?
(79)
3. Данные объемом 60 Мбайт передаются из пункта А в пункт Б по каналу связи, обеспечивающему скорость

Слайд 44. Документ объёмом 40 Мбайт можно передать с одного компьютера на

другой двумя способами:
А. Сжать архиватором, передать архив по каналу связи, распаковать.
Б. Передать по каналу связи без использования архиватора.
Какой способ быстрее и насколько, если:
средняя скорость передачи данных по каналу связи составляет 220 бит в секунду;
объём сжатого архиватором документа равен 40% исходного;
время, требуемое на сжатие документа, – 10 секунд, на распаковку – 2 секунды?
В ответе напишите букву А, если быстрее способ А, или Б, если быстрее способ Б. Сразу после буквы напишите число, обозначающее, на сколько секунд один способ быстрее другого.
Так, например, если способ Б быстрее способа А на 50 секунд, в ответе нужно написать Б50.
Единицы измерения «секунд», «сек.», «с.» к ответу добавлять не нужно.
4. Документ объёмом 40 Мбайт можно передать с одного компьютера на другой двумя способами: А. Сжать архиватором,

Слайд 5О каком информационном процессе данная задача?

О каком информационном процессе данная задача?

Слайд 6Сжатие данных

Сжатие данных

Слайд 7Сжатие данных— алгоритмическое преобразование данных, производимое с целью уменьшения занимаемого ими

объёма
Сжатие данных— алгоритмическое преобразование данных, производимое с целью уменьшения занимаемого ими объёма

Слайд 8Коэффициент сжатия – соотношение исходного и сжатого файла

Коэффициент сжатия – соотношение исходного и сжатого файла

Слайд 10Алгоритмы сжатия

Алгоритмы сжатия

Слайд 11Алгоритм RLE -кодирование цепочек одинаковых символов
100
100
200 байтов
Файл qq.txt
Файл qq.rle (сжатый)
4 байта
+
-

Алгоритм RLE -кодирование цепочек одинаковых символов100100200 байтовФайл qq.txtФайл qq.rle (сжатый)4 байта+-

Слайд 12Префиксный код – это код, в котором ни одно кодовое слово

не является началом другого кодового слова (условие Фано).
Префиксный код – это код, в котором ни одно кодовое слово не является началом другого кодового слова

Слайд 13Код Шеннона-Фано
Сообщения алфавита источника выписывают в порядке убывания вероятностей их появления.


Далее разделяют их на две части так, чтобы суммарные вероятности сообщений в каждой из этих частей были по возможности почти одинаковыми.
Припишем сообщениям первой части в качестве первого символа – 0, а второй – 1 (можно наоборот).
Затем каждая из этих частей (если она содержит более одного сообщения) делится на две по возможности равновероятные части, и в качестве второго символа для первой из них берется 0, а для второй – 1.
Этот процесс повторяется, пока в каждой из полученных частей не останется по одному сообщению
Код Шеннона-ФаноСообщения алфавита источника выписывают в порядке убывания вероятностей их появления. Далее разделяют их на две части

Слайд 14Код Шеннона-Фано
Количество символов в сообщении:
На 2 группы с примерно равным

числом символов:

начинаются с 0

начинаются с 1

начинаются с 11

+

-

Код Шеннона-ФаноКоличество символов в сообщении: На 2 группы с примерно равным числом символов: начинаются с 0начинаются с

Слайд 15Код Шеннона-Фано
учитывается частота символов
не нужен символ-разделитель
код префиксный – можно декодировать по

мере поступления данных

нужно заранее знать частоты символов
код неоптимален
при ошибке в передаче сложно восстановить «хвост»
не учитывает повторяющиеся последовательности символов

Код Шеннона-Фаноучитывается частота символовне нужен символ-разделителькод префиксный – можно декодировать по мере поступления данныхнужно заранее знать частоты

Слайд 16Алгоритм Хаффмана
Буквы алфавита сообщений выписывают в основной столбец таблицы кодирования в

порядке убывания вероятностей.
Две последние буквы объединяют в одну вспомогательную букву, которой приписывают суммарную вероятность.
Вероятность букв, не участвовавших в объединении, и полученная суммарная вероятность слова располагаются в порядке убывания вероятностей в дополнительном столбце, а две последние объединяют.
Процесс продолжается до тех пор, пока не получим единственную вспомогательную букву с вероятностью, равной единице
Алгоритм ХаффманаБуквы алфавита сообщений выписывают в основной столбец таблицы кодирования в порядке убывания вероятностей. Две последние буквы

Слайд 17Алгоритм Хаффмана
1
0
_ - 1
О – 01
Е – 001
Н – 0001
Т –

0000

_

О

Е

Н

Т

1

0

1

0

1

0

Алгоритм Хаффмана10_ - 1О – 01Е – 001Н – 0001Т – 0000 _ОЕНТ101010

Слайд 18Алгоритм Хаффмана
код оптимальный среди алфавитных кодов
нужно заранее знать частоты символов
при ошибке

в передаче сложно восстановить «хвост»
не учитывает повторяющиеся последовательности символов
Алгоритм Хаффманакод оптимальный среди алфавитных кодовнужно заранее знать частоты символовпри ошибке в передаче сложно восстановить «хвост»не учитывает

Слайд 20Сжатие с потерями

Сжатие с потерями

Слайд 21Алгоритм JPEG
При сжатии изображение преобразуется из цветового пространства RGB в YCbCr

(Y – яркость, Cb – «синева», Cr- «краснота»

Перевод осуществляется по следующей формуле

Алгоритм JPEGПри сжатии изображение преобразуется из цветового пространства RGB в YCbCr (Y – яркость, Cb – «синева»,

Слайд 22Сжатие JPEG
Идея: глаз наиболее чувствителен к яркости
12 чисел
Дано: изображение 2×2 pt

Сжатие JPEGИдея: глаз наиболее чувствителен к яркости12 чиселДано: изображение 2×2 pt

Слайд 23Сжатие звука (MP3)
Битрейт – это число бит, используемых для кодирования 1

секунды звука (Кб/с)

Дано:
d=44 кГц
S=2
t=1 c
b=16 б
Битрейт =256 Кб/с
Степень сжатия - ?

V = bd t S
V=44000 16 1 2= 1375
Степень сжатия=1375/256=5

Сжатие звука (MP3)Битрейт – это число бит, используемых для кодирования 1 секунды звука (Кб/с)Дано: d=44 кГцS=2t=1 cb=16

Слайд 24Сжатие: итоги
Хорошо сжимаются:
тексты (*.txt)
документы (*.doc)
несжатые рисунки (*.bmp)
несжатый звук (*.wav)
несжатое видео (*.avi)
Плохо

сжимаются:
случайные данные
сжатые данные в архивах (*.zip, *.rar, *.7z)
сжатые рисунки (*.jpg, *.gif, *.png)
сжатый звук (*.mp3, *.aac)
сжатое видео (*.mpg, *.mp4, *.mov)
Сжатие: итогиХорошо сжимаются:тексты (*.txt)документы (*.doc)несжатые рисунки (*.bmp)несжатый звук (*.wav)несжатое видео (*.avi)Плохо сжимаются:случайные данныесжатые данные в архивах (*.zip,

Слайд 255. Производилась двухканальная (стерео) звукозапись с частотой дискретизации 64 кГц и

24-битным разрешением. В результате был получен файл размером 120 Мбайт, сжатие данных не производилось. Определите приблизительно, сколько времени (в минутах) производилась запись. В качестве ответа укажите ближайшее к времени записи целое число, кратное 5.
5. Производилась двухканальная (стерео) звукозапись с частотой дискретизации 64 кГц и 24-битным разрешением. В результате был получен

Слайд 266. Музыкальный фрагмент был оцифрован и записан в виде файла без

использования сжатия данных. Получившийся файл был передан в город А по каналу связи за 30 секунд. Затем тот же музыкальный фрагмент был оцифрован повторно с разрешением в 2 раза выше и частотой дискретизации в 1,5 раза меньше, чем в первый раз. Сжатие данных не производилось. Полученный файл был передан в город Б; пропускная способность канала связи с городом Б в 4 раза выше, чем канала связи с городом А. Сколько секунд длилась передача файла в город Б? В ответе запишите только целое число, единицу измерения писать не нужно.
6. Музыкальный фрагмент был оцифрован и записан в виде файла без использования сжатия данных. Получившийся файл был

Слайд 277. Рисунок размером 512 на 256 пикселей занимает в памяти 64

Кбайт (без учёта сжатия). Найдите максимально возможное количество цветов в палитре изображения.
7. Рисунок размером 512 на 256 пикселей занимает в памяти 64 Кбайт (без учёта сжатия). Найдите максимально

Слайд 288. Какой минимальный объём памяти (в Кбайт) нужно зарезервировать, чтобы можно

было сохранить любое растровое изображение размером 64 на 64 пикселов при условии, что в изображении могут использоваться 256 различных цветов? В ответе запишите только целое число, единицу измерения писать не нужно.
8. Какой минимальный объём памяти (в Кбайт) нужно зарезервировать, чтобы можно было сохранить любое растровое изображение размером

Что такое shareslide.ru?

Это сайт презентаций, где можно хранить и обмениваться своими презентациями, докладами, проектами, шаблонами в формате PowerPoint с другими пользователями. Мы помогаем школьникам, студентам, учителям, преподавателям хранить и обмениваться учебными материалами.


Для правообладателей

Яндекс.Метрика

Обратная связь

Email: Нажмите что бы посмотреть